My Beauty Diary Mexico Cactus Mask


Saturday September 22, 2012   

I really trust the brand My Beauty Diary. They have a ton of facial mask options and the majority of their series don’t break me out. This Mexico Cactus Mask I received from Yesstyle is especially gentle! It’s one of my absolute favorites now. It’s an extremely moisturizing mask that’s great for calming a little sunburn. The scent is also relaxing. It’s an aloe based mask but the fragrance is a bit sweet thanks to the floral ingredients of Calendula, date, and cactus flower.

Extremely effective in moisturizing and great energizing fresh scent. I love to use this one right after I get home from work and remove my makeup. :)

Moisture Surge and Seal: Cactus flower essence is enriched with natural nutrients that form a hydrated protection shield on the skin surface to enhance moisture and effectively reduce water loss within skin. Emulate how cacti in extremely severe environmental conditions are able to retain and seal water content in their leave. Combined with Date essence found in desserts, this mask boosts moisture retention in skin and cells as well as softens texture for a smooth, radiant, and plump look!
